## Service Account: gpu-memprof

The gpu-memprof account runs the Vramlens profiler across the Thornback training cluster. It samples allocator stats every 10s and pushes flame data to the Heapline dashboard. Support: do not restart the profiler agents directly; use the Vramlens control API, which drains buffers first. Kill -9 loses up to 10 minutes of samples. Scope: read GPU telemetry, write to the profiling bucket, nothing else. If a customer report needs a manual trace pull, call the control API with the key below.

gateway credential: kto23_LX9A4ys6i4nzHtpOLNLodKK

Thanks for the migration work on the Quillbase adapter. For zero-downtime changes, plugin authors must follow the expand/contract pattern: add the new column, dual-write behind a flag, backfill in batches, then drop the old path in a later release. Please split this PR accordingly — the drop belongs in its own migration. Batch sizes and pause intervals matter a lot here; the values we've validated in staging are these.

constants for bagaf-hadup:
QUOTAS = {
    "quenael": 1,
    "ralwyn": 1,
    "oliath": 2,
    "ulaael": 2,
}

Subject: Chip reader cut-over complete

Quick summary for review. The Stridepoint timing-chip readers at the Corvell Marathon course were cut over to the new ingest service last night. All twelve mats reported clean reads during the dry run; dedupe window behaved as expected. Old pollers are decommissioned. Please review against the settings the readers are now running, listed below.

deployment values, faduf-tawep:
SORDOR_LOG_LEVEL=error
SORDOR_METRICS_HOST=metrics.sordor.nelvrolabs.internal
SORDOR_POOL_SIZE=4